This report provides a comprehensive analysis of human resource management practices, specifically focusing on the recruitment, selection, and training methods for an HR Generalist position. The report begins by examining three recruitment methods: effective job advertisements, e-recruitment, and internal appointments, and their relevance to attracting suitable candidates. It then outlines the criteria for selection, including biodata assessment, personality tests, communication skills, experience, and occupational interest, and discusses various selection methods such as preliminary screening, telephonic interviews, face-to-face interviews, and cultural fit assessments. The report also details essential employment checks, including qualification verification, security checks, and medical evaluations. Furthermore, the report delves into training, including an induction-training program, specifying individual and organizational needs, along with a detailed schedule covering topics, content, responsible persons, resources, places, and methods of training. The report concludes by providing a thorough understanding of the HR Generalist role and its critical functions within an organization.
